How much do ob gyn assistant j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 10, 2026, the average yearly pay for ob gyn assistant in Baton Rouge, LA is $117,142.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$33,728.00 and $231,014.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What skills and qualifications are needed to be an Ob Gyn assistant?

To thrive as an Ob Gyn Assistant, you need a solid understanding of medical terminology, women's health procedures, and basic clinical skills, often supported by a medical assistant certificate or associate's degree. Familiarity with electronic health records (EHR) systems, patient scheduling software, and routine laboratory equipment is typically required. Strong interpersonal skills, attention to detail, and the ability to provide compassionate care help you excel in this patient-facing role. These skills and qualities are essential for ensuring accurate clinical support, smooth office operations, and a positive patient experience in obstetrics and gynecology settings.

How to become an Ob Gyn Assistant?

To become an Ob Gyn Assistant, candidates typically need a high school diploma or equivalent, followed by completing a certified medical assisting or related program. Relevant skills include patient communication, basic medical procedures, and familiarity with medical tools; certification as a Certified Medical Assistant (CMA) or similar credential can enhance job prospects.

What is an Ob Gyn assistant?

Ob Gyn Assistants are healthcare professionals who support obstetricians and gynecologists in providing care to women, particularly related to reproductive health, pregnancy, and childbirth. Their duties can include preparing exam rooms, assisting during medical procedures, taking patient histories, scheduling appointments, and providing patient education. Ob Gyn Assistants may also handle administrative tasks and help ensure that the clinic or practice runs smoothly. They play a vital role in helping patients feel comfortable and informed during their visits. Training requirements can vary, but many have backgrounds as medical assistants or similar healthcare roles.

What are the daily responsibilities of an Ob Gyn assistant?

An Ob Gyn Assistant typically handles a mix of clinical and administrative tasks, such as preparing exam rooms, taking patient histories and vital signs, assisting with procedures, and ensuring that medical instruments are sterilized and ready for use. They often act as a liaison between patients and physicians, helping to explain procedures and provide reassurance. Their support is crucial for maintaining efficient workflow and a positive patient experience in busy obstetrics and gynecology practices.

General Duties:
This position duties are to ensure the physician's schedule flows efficiently by preparing for patient visits and assist physician during exams.  After the visit the exam rooms are to be cleaned and prepared for the next patient.  Specimens are to be labeled for laboratory testing and placed in appropriate location to be collected.  


Job Responsibilities:

  • Greet and escort patients into exam area timely. 
  • Update patient demographics and medical history in EMR system
  • Obtain vital signs
  • Record chief complaint and start notes for physician
  • Check schedule and organize patient flow
  • Assist with collecting and labeling specimens for laboratory testing
  • Enter lab orders as directed by physician
  • Ensure encounter forms are completed before directing patient to the discharge area
  • Ensures exam rooms are clean, neat and fully supplied
  • Maintain strict patient confidentiality and complies with HIPAA regulations
  • Maintain open communication between nurses and physician
